Abstract
It is well known that an irreducible algebraic curve is rational (i.e. parametric) if and only if its genus is zero. In this paper, given a tolerance and an -irreducible algebraic affine plane curve of proper degree , we introduce the notion of -rationality, and we provide an algorithm to parametrize approximately affine -rational plane curves, without exact singularities at infinity, by means of linear systems of -degree curves. The algorithm outputs a rational parametrization of a rational curve of degree at most which has the same points at infinity as . Moreover, although we do not provide a theoretical analysis, our empirical analysis shows that and are close in practice.
